What rights does the debtor have during a seizure in Peru?
During a seizure in Peru, the debtor has the right to be adequately notified about the legal process, present evidence and arguments in his defense, and request review of the precautionary measure. Additionally, you can propose payment alternatives or agreements to avoid complete execution of the embargo.
Can taxpayers in El Salvador request a review of default interest on their tax records?
Yes, taxpayers in El Salvador can request a review of default interest on their tax records if they believe the amounts are incorrect or unfair. They must submit documentation to support their request.
